Silicon and carbon both are the members of 14th group. But
Silicon tetrachloride reacts with water while carbon
tetrachloride does not . this is due to the fact that the
carbon does not have d - orbitals to accept lone pair of
electron from water while silicon has vacant d - orbitals
to accept lone pair of electron from water.

I've learnt two reasons for this. One, as many have stated, that C does not have low enough energy orbitals for water to act as a lewis acid. but then, this doesn't quite explain why the SN2 reaction happens in organic compounds.

The other explanation is that the Cl atoms are bulky and provide steric hindrance for the water molecules to reach the carbon atom, whereas the Si atom being bigger, the Cl atoms do not pose as great an impediment.
